Smart key systems are found in a wide range of modern cars. They allow you to unlock the car with a push of a button and allow you to start the car with no physical key. This is a fantastic convenience, but there are also some downsides. Consider the pros and cons of a push-to start Audi key before making your decision.

Many people don't keep spare keys in a secure place. It is easy to replace your key should you lose it. Contact the dealership or a locksmith in your area. They can usually offer a replacement faster and at a cheaper price.

You can purchase an OEM key from an Audi dealer for $280 to $450 They may also charge an additional fee to program the key. Locksmiths are typically cheaper and have more flexibility in terms of the timeframe for making an replacement key.
